In Ingglish — phonetic English where every spelling always makes the same sound — the word “proctoscope” is spelled “prawktoskohp”. Here is how it sounds out, one sound at a time:
| Ingglish | p | r | aw | k | t | o | s | k | oh | p |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| IPA | /p/ | /ɹ/ | /ɔ/ | /k/ | /t/ | /ɑ/ | /s/ | /k/ | /oʊ/ | /p/ |
English writes “proctoscope” with
11 letters for 10 sounds. Ingglish writes it
“prawktoskohp” — no silent letters, and the same spelling
always makes the same sound, so you can read it exactly as it looks.
